Information for this tour was contributed by Grant Smith. The American Theater opened before 1914. [1] The theater had a ballroom upstairs which was covered with beautiful Art Deco. After seeing a movie, patrons would go up to the ballroom to dance. Between 1927 and 1929, the theater was renamed the Granada Theatre. The building later became W. T. Grant Co. and the ballroom was use for stock.
